GENERAL SAFETY REGULATIONS
The machine described in this manual has been designed in accordance with Community Machine Directive 2006/42/EEC
(Machine Directive). It shall be the responsibility of the machine manager to act in accordance with all community directives and current
national laws with respect to work environments to guarantee the safety and health of all operators.

PACKAGED MACHINE HANDLING
This machine arrives packaged on a pallet.
Its weight and dimensions are detailed in the “DATA SHEET” chapter of this manual.
The forklift or transpallet must be positioned so that the centre of the package is approximately at the centre of the forklift itself. The package
must be handled with extreme care, avoiding collisions or hoisting at excessive heights.
Do not rest packages on top of each other.
DIRECTIONS FOR UNPACKING THE MACHINE
Machine unpacking shall be performed with care and delicacy. First remove the clips at the bottom of the box which are holding the box to
the pallet, then hoist the container. The machine is being held rm to the frame supports, which must be removed. At this point, the machine
must be brought to the ground by means of a metal or wooden ramp.
We recommend conserving these supports for any future transport.
UNPACKAGED MACHINE HANDLING
The unpacked machine must be checked and batteries must be inserted if they have not already been installed. In the event that the
machine must be handled after use for short transport, remove brushes and squeegees; for longer transports it is best to repack the machine
in its original box. Please note that the machine can be moved by means of pushing for short distances.
